What style of dress did you choose?

This is the best place to start your search for bridal jewelry. The neckline plays a huge part in deciding what type of jewelry will go well with it. Just about anything will go well with a strapless or sweetheart wedding gown. Wider necklines, like a boat neck or wide v, pair well with a statement necklace. What color is the gown?

Before you say "white, of course!" know that most gowns aren't white white. There are different shades of white. As well, there gowns with lots of silver beading. If your gown has beading, try jewelry with cooler tones and silver plating to match. If your dress is a warm ivory or cream color, go for pieces with warmer tones and gold plating. How will you wear your hair?

If you haven't yet thought about your hair, you should do so now that you have your dress. Up-dos are perfect for statement earrings and strapless gowns. If you won't be wearing a necklace and want your earrings to stand out, you'll want your hair up and pulled back. Wearing your hair down is going to hide your earrings, so a down-do will work best if your statement piece is your necklace.


What do you want people to focus on?

If you're wearing a statement necklace, you might want to choose earrings that won't over power them. Most brides don't want both a statement necklace and a pair of statement earrings. Pair a large necklace with studs and bold, drop earrings with no necklace at all.
